Aldrington train station is devoid of a traditional ticket office, but fear not—it has you covered with automated ticket machines. These handy machines are accessible for all travelers, including those who need the Disabled Persons Railcard. Induction loops keep communication clear, and smartcard validators are present for your convenience. However, while functional, the station lacks waiting rooms and luggage storage facilities, so plan accordingly.
Accessibility is an important consideration here as the station doesn’t have step-free access and there’s no ramp for train access. Assistance can be arranged prior through Southern’s Assisted Travel service, or by utilizing the help points situated on the platforms. Staff assistance on-site is limited, but most trains have staff ready to assist on arrival.
Travel doesn't stop at just the train at Aldrington. The station links with various modes of transport to ensure you complete your journey with ease. Though it doesn’t have in-station taxi or car hire services, bus information and rail replacement services are available, complete with live updates on screens as you exit the platforms.

Bexhill Train Station is well geared to cater to most passenger needs, with a ticket office that opens bright and early at 6:10 AM on weekdays and Saturdays, and slightly later on Sundays at 8:10 AM. An array of user-friendly ticket machines are available, accessible to everyone including those with disabilities, allowing travelers to easily purchase and collect tickets on-site. For enhanced convenience, smartcard users will find this station accommodating with issuance and validation facilities.
Catering comprehensively to passengers with varying mobility, Bexhill station offers step-free access through certain areas, albeit via long ramps. Assistance for boarding trains is readily available with the staff-operated ramp system. The station also ensures passenger safety and support with comprehensive CCTV coverage, help points, and a well-staffed environment offering assistance well into the night. For passengers requiring extra assistance, pre-booking through the assisted travel helpline is a practical option.
Traveling onward from Bexhill station is a breeze. The well-positioned taxi rank right outside the station ensures quick land travel connectivity, and bus services in the vicinity further support your journey, making it easy to transition from rail to road.
